Lakeitha

♀ Girl

How to Pronounce Lakeitha

Pronounced luh-KEE-thuh /ləˈkiː.θə/Medium

Meaning: Lakeitha is a coined name pairing the productive La- prefix with a Keitha or Keisha element. It belongs to the creative wave of African-American girls' names of the 1970s that combined euphonic sounds rather than a single inherited root.Low

In 30 seconds: Lakeitha joins the melodic La- prefix to a Keitha sound (said 'luh-KEE-thuh'). A 1970s coinage that peaked at the end of that decade.

History & Origin

Lakeitha combines the La- prefix, a signature of mid-century African-American name-building, with a Keitha or Keisha element. It rose in the 1970s and peaked around 1979, a name prized for sound and originality rather than a fixed meaning.

A Lakeitha from the peak is now in her late forties. Like many coinages of its moment it reads as firmly of its era and has not revived, but it remains a smooth, easily said name with a clear rhythm.

Did you know? Lakeitha sits in a large, inventive family of La- names — Lakeisha, Lakisha, Latisha — that flourished among African-American families through the 1970s and 80s.
